Pasta alla Norma

A classic Sicilian pasta dish with rich tomato sauce, tender eggplant, and creamy ricotta salata.

Ingredients

For 4 servings

  • 2 eggplant
  • 4 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 cloves garlic
  • 28 ounces canned tomatoes
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• salt — to taste
  • black pepper — to taste
  • 10 basil leaves
  • 100 grams ricotta salata
  • 400 grams pasta
  • 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es

Instructions

  1. 1

    Cut the eggplants into small cubes and season with salt; let them sit for 10 minutes to draw out moisture.

  2. 2

    Rinse and pat dry the eggplant with paper towels.

  3. 3

    In a large skillet,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at and sauté the eggplant until golden brown. Set aside.

  4. 4

    Add the remaining 2 tablespoons of olive oil to the skillet. Sauté the minced garlic until fragrant, about 1 minute.

  5. 5

    Add the canned tomatoes, oregano, red pepper flakes, salt, and black pepper. Simmer for 15 minutes, stirring occasionally.

  6. 6

    Meanwhile, cook the pasta according to package instructions until al dente. Reserve some pasta water and drain the pasta.

  7. 7

    Add the eggplant back to the tomato sauce and stir to combine. If needed, use reserved pasta water to adjust the sauce consistency.

  8. 8

    Toss the pasta with the sauce in the skillet until well coated.

  9. 9

    Serve topped with crumbled ricotta salata and fresh basil leaves.
